Transaction 70ff65b2be55fb9817441fec9f9d5414066850956a2abe6d003d04e51452afc8

1 Input
2 Outputs
  • 70ff65b2be55fb9817441fec9f9d5414066850956a2abe6d003d04e51452afc8:0
  • value  8700000
    address  3Dsf3TfLXcMWHcukwqnSqAxKvVPhEB2DV9
  • 70ff65b2be55fb9817441fec9f9d5414066850956a2abe6d003d04e51452afc8:1
  • value  6081004739
    address  3CRTdRTQvh9RNUGFKyD3tvSPgbu23GbeSK